Partner with our backend team to build a highly responsive and intuitive web app
Craft the frontend for features that connect software tools, aggregate and report on data
Implement reusable components and libraries, build and maintain a style guide for app consistency
Drive efforts to continuously improve the efficiency, stability, and scalability of our software
Help define and grow our engineering culture, processes and tools
Requirements
5+ years building web applications at scale
Deep understanding of React fundamentals, experience in optimizing for performance and scalability
Experience developing consumer-facing or web applications that serve a large user base, demonstrating an ability to maintain performance under heavy usage
Strong grasp of component-based architecture and state management patterns; experience with state management libraries
Proficiency with modern technologies like React, Next.js, TypeScript/Node.js, NestJS, TypeORM, PostgreSQL and RESTful APIs
The motivation and drive to be a self-starter, with the ability to navigate ambiguity and [very] rapidly evolving roadmap
Excellent communication skills, strong work ethic
Benefits
Remote work
Unlimited PTO
401k retirement plan
Medical, dental and vision insurance with 100% of premiums covered
Quarterly team offsites
Home office stipend
Learning and growth stipend
Applicant Tracking System Keywords
Tip: use these terms in your resume and cover letter to boost ATS matches.